Job Title: Custodial Porter

Reports To: Assistant Director of Operations

Location: Cornish Commons at Cornish College of the Arts - Seattle, WA

Compensation: $21.00- $23.00 per hour, onsite parking (provided during working hours) and competitive benefits package

FLSA Status: Non-Exempt

Summary:

The Porter is primarily responsible for maintaining cleanliness of interior and exterior of the building along with garbage and recycling management.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Assist in maintaining the grounds, building common areas, and exterior of the building.
  • Assist in cleaning debris from sidewalk.
  • Utilizes electric tools such as a trash caddy and power washer.
  • Manages removal of all trash and refuse from the building.
  • Assist in painting and drywall projects when necessary.
  • Replace light bulbs, lamps, and clean fixtures.
  • Clean and turn vacant units for moving in tenants.
  • Assist in performing basic maintenance functions that may be assigned by the Maintenance Supervisor.
  • Assist in escorting and monitoring vendors while on-site providing a service.
  • Respond quickly to emergency situations and customer concerns.
  • Comply with all applicable codes, regulations, governmental agency, and company directives as related to building operations and practices safe work habits.
  • Identifies and reports work orders for maintenance needs.
  • Contribute to the overall success of the maintenance department by performing essential duties and responsibilities as assigned.

Qualifications:

  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ED).
  • Custodial experience with willingness to learn general maintenance tasks.
  • Demonstrate proficiency in verbal communication.
  • Possess strong customer service skills.
  • Ability to move and lift to 50lbs and navigate up and down stairs.
  • Must have troubleshooting and diagnostic skills.
